What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: (Construction Reference: 1926.59)    (a) On or about 7/12/2018 at Patrick Nash Design located at 373 Van Sinderen Ave Brooklyn, NY 11207, workers using 100% acetone during finishing of neon lights were exposed to hazardous chemicals including but not limited to acetone without being provided access to a written hazard communication program. 29 CFR 1910.1200(g)(8): The employer did not ensure that material safety data sheets were readily accessible to the employees in their work area during each work shift: (Construction Reference: 1926.59)  (a) On or about 7/12/2018 at Patrick Nash Design located at 373 Van Sinderen Ave Brooklyn, NY 11207, workers using 100% acetone during finishing of neon lights were exposed to hazardous chemicals including but not limited to acetone without being provided access to safety data sheets. 29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employees were not provided effective information and training on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ment and whenever a new hazard that the employees had not been previously trained about was introduced into their work area: (Construction Reference: 1926.59)  (a) On or about 7/12/2018 at Patrick Nash Design located at 373 Van Sinderen Ave Brooklyn, NY 11207, workers spraying concentrated acidic cleaner to mortar were exposed to hazardous chemicals including but not limited to Hydrogen chloride weight % 10-30 without being provided access to safety data sheets by the employer.
